The Holiday Jingle & Mingle Run is run on the El Dorado Trail in beautiful historic Placerville. The path is surrounded with beautiful oak trees, rolling hills, and incredible views. All races follow PINK RIBBONS for an out-and-back course heading eastward from the starting line at Mosquito Road.
For each distance, the path goes up a steady 3% grade to the turnaround point, and the second half of the race is downhill all the way to the finish. The Kids Run, 1 Mile, 5K, 10K, and 15K courses are run entirely on a paved bike path. The pavement ends at about 5.6 miles into the half marathon course, and the remainder of the distance to the turnaround point is run on a dirt and gravel path. There are several road crossings along the course. Most are private roads or smaller feeder roads with relatively little traffic, but each crossing will be marked with yellow ribbons to alert runners of a crossing with vehicular traffic. The race is held rain or shine. Strollers are allowed in the 5K, 10K, and 15K.

Nice local race without a lot of bells & whistles. The 10k course is a steady incline for almost 3 miles before you run over the freeway overcrossing to turn around, but then you are treated to a glorious downhill run on the way back. This race goes all out with the finish line food and snacks and family and spectators were invited to indulge. Entry fee does not include a shirt (can buy it separately) and the finisher medals are nothing special, so this is not a race you do for the bling. Overall it was a hard race but fun.
